Businesses invited to table tennis contest

By Laura Collacott  Monday Jun 8, 2015

Entries close this Friday (12th June) for Battle of the Paddle, a unique, ping-pong based business networking event. Bristol companies are invited to connect over a game of table tennis in a tournament open to all skill levels and sectors.

“Our aim is to get employees out of the office at lunchtime or after work this summer,” says co-organiser Dylan Pepler from Blackstar Solutions. “We’re urging business to get involved; not only will it give them kudos but table tennis increases concentration and alertness, stimulates brain function and develops tactical thinking.”

The idea grew from the Bristol City Council Ping table tennis tables when local sponsors found a lunchtime game a great opportunity to engage with out businesses “away from the standard (sometimes rigid) networking events”. The inaugural tournament played out in November 2014 with more than 40 teams taking part. The top 16 were selected from two pools, going on to compete in a knockout at Vivo Sports Club.

The Summer Series will be played in one large pool to give company teams maximum games and networking opportunities. Matches can be arranged via the website to fit around work commitments. Teams are made up of two players with no limit to the number of teams each company can field.
